Beginning from the selection of the yarn all the way to exporting the finished product, Proline has a fully integrated, controlled, state of the art vertical unit with knitting, dyeing, washing, finishing, cutting and sewing all in house at a central facility in Karachi, Pakistan. We have grown from 10,000 ft2 in 1990 to over 130,000 ft2 presently. In 1990 we started as a commercial knitter.
Gaining from the experience and demand from our customers we ventured into establishing a dyeing plant. In 1995 we added a sewing unit to the building. In 2000, vertically integrated ourselves and added a modern automated dyeing and finishing plant. In 2002 we invested again into a state of the art cutting and sewing plant with the most modern CAD/CAM machinery along with the latest sewing machines. In 2006 we invested in our sewing department by adding more machines and floor space as well as ventured into manufacturing woven garments. Today our plant is ISO as well as WRAP(Worldwide Responsible Apparel Production) certified. Knitting unit
Our knitting unit comprises of computerized circular fabric knitting machines. These machines are capable of knitting various types of fabrics such as jersey, interlock, pique, fleece, french terry, herringbone, thermal and performance fabrics.
In order to improve efficiency and cost effectiveness, Proline has knitting machines in various diameters from 16’’ all the way to 34" in various gauges. The unit also has computerized rib-knitting machine and sophisticated computerized flatbed Japanese trim knitting machines. 100% of the fabric knitted is checked on special fabric inspection machines. For certain clients we store pre knitted fabrics to reduce the time cycle of product.

Dyeing and finishing unit
Proline has a modern plant capable of dyeing cotton and synthetic fabrics using high temperature dyeing machines as well as atmospheric dyeing machines. We use azo-free eco-friendly reactive dyes and have a 3.6 Million Kg. annual capacity. The fully integrated dye house comprises of a number of machines that are capable of dyeing, stentering, heat setting, hydro extraction, washing, tension less drying, compacting and brushing. The equipment we use is from leading manufacturers such as Thies, Fongs, Sclavos, Gaston County, Heliot, Ruckh, TubeTex, Ferraro and Riley. We further have a number of dedicated sample dyeing machines that can be used to dye cotton and synthetic fabrics for sampling purposes. We have the ability to finish in tubular as well as open width.

Laboratory and R&D facility
Proline has a fully equipped in house laboratory for monitoring and researching fabric behavior, color, shrinkage and recipes. Equipment used includes a Macbeth Color Spectrophotometer, Ahiba Nuance Infra Red Dye Bath, High Temperature machine, Light Cabinets, Gyro Wash Machine, Oven, Perspiro Meter, Incubator, Light Fastness Testing Machine, Washing machine, Tumble dryer and crock meter.
